The video discusses the catastrophic impact of twin disasters, an earthquake and a tsunami, in Indonesia. The death toll is over 800, with many missing. The tsunami hit Palu at high speeds, causing massive destruction. Authorities face challenges due to poor infrastructure, lack of water, electricity, and communication. The National Disaster Management Agency struggles with budget cuts, and outdated warning systems. Recovery and rescue efforts are ongoing, with significant challenges ahead for the government.
